Araiband

Araiband is a village located in Takhatpur tehsil of Bilaspur district in Chhattisgarh, India. It is situated 9km away from sub-district headquarter Takhatpur (tehsildar office) and 28km away from district headquarter Bilaspur. As per 2009 stats, Araiband village is also a gram panchayat.

About Araiband

According to Census 2011, the location code or village code of Araiband is 438605. The village spans a total geographical area of 558.07 hectares, and the pincode of the locality is 495330. Takhatpur is nearest town to Araiband village for all major economic activities, which is approximately 9km away.

When it comes to local governance, Araiband village is administered by a Sarpanch, the elected head of the village, in accordance with the Constitution of India and the Panchayati Raj Act. The village falls under the Takhatpur Vidhan Sabha constituency for state-level representation and the Bilaspur Lok Sabha constituency for national parliamentary elections. Population of Araiband

Below is a concise population overview of Araiband as per the Census 2011 data. The table highlights the key population metrics categorized by gender and social groups.

ParticularsTotalMaleFemale
Total Population 1,182 625 557
Child Population (0–6 yrs) 201 103 98
Scheduled Castes (SC) 782 411 371
Scheduled Tribes (ST) 55 25 30
Literate Population 626 399 227
Illiterate Population 556 226 330

Here's a detailed summary of the Basic Population Details of Araiband village:

  • The total population of Araiband village is around 1,182, including approximately 625 males and 557 females, with a sex ratio of 891 females per 1,000 males.
  • There are about 201 children aged 0–6 years in Araiband village, reflecting the young population in the village.
  • Araiband village has 782 people belonging to the Scheduled Castes (SC) and 55 residents from the Scheduled Tribes (ST).
  • The literacy rate of Araiband village is about 52.96%, with male literacy at 63.84% and female literacy at 40.75%.
  • There are around 253 households in Araiband village.

Connectivity of Araiband

Connectivity plays a major role in improving access, opportunities, and overall development of villages like Araiband. As per the 2011 stats, Araiband had access to public bus service, private bus service and railway station.

Connectivity Type Status (in year 2011)
Public Bus Service Available
Private Bus Service Available within 5 - 10 km distance
Railway Station Available within 10+ km distance
